Перейти к содержимому

Записать переменные в файл

Описание

Блок сохраняет указанные переменные в файл хранилища. Требуется указать путь и имя файла без расширения — в результате будут созданы три файла с расширениями .dat, .dir и .bak. Каждая переменная сохраняется как пара «ключ–значение», где ключ — имя переменной.

image_1

Описание параметров

Блок имеет один параметр:

  1. Путь к файлу - путь к файлу (наименование без расширения);

    Тип данных: строка

    Пример: C:\users\user\Desktop\my_data

  2. Данные - данные для записи;

    Тип данных: dict (Словарь)

    Пример: {'key': 'value'}


Пример использования

В данном примере будет выполняться основной алгоритм Процесс 1:

  1. Присваиваются значения переменным login, password;
  2. Создается словарь data с значениями и ключами переменных;
  3. Запись словаря с значениями переменных в файл;
  4. Вызов функции из другого процесса для чтения данных из файла Процесс 2.
image_2

Алгоритм процесса Процесс 2:

  1. Объявление функции get_data;
  2. Чтение данных из файла с помощью блока Прочитать переменные из файла;
  3. Вывод на экран значений переменных.
image_3

Результат

Запуск основного алгоритма:

image_4